
No. 10 Soccer Readies for Weekend Slate Against No. 14 TCU and Utah

Bears head to Fort Worth for a top 15 rivalry matchup versus TCU
By Rylee White, Baylor Athletics Communications
WACO, Texas – No. 10 Baylor hits the road Thursday to face No. 14 TCU in Fort Worth at 7 p.m., before returning home Sunday to host Utah at 1 p.m. at Betty Lou Mays Field for the final home match of the regular season. Both matches will stream live on ESPN+.
The Bears (10-1-2, 5-1 Big 12) enter the weekend riding a five-match win streak, highlighted by recent victories over now-No. 21 Colorado, 2-1, and BYU, 4-2. Baylor has defeated every ranked opponent they have faced this season, including then-No. 17 Mississippi State and then-No. 14 Kansas. Boasting a 5-1 Big 12 record, the Bears hold the top spot in the conference with their solo loss on the season being their league opener against Texas Tech on Sept. 19.
TCU (10-2-1, 4-1-1 Big 12) entered the season as a favorite to win the conference, but recently fell 3-1 to Colorado and settled for a 1-1 draw with then- No.11 Texas Tech in Big 12 play. The Horned Frogs also have yet to drop a match to a ranked opponent this season, defeating both then-No.9 Iowa and then-No.14 Kansas.
Baylor and TCU are set to meet for the 27th time in program history, with the Bears leading the all-time series 14-6-6. The teams last met a season ago, playing to a 1-1 draw in Waco. The Bears are in the hunt for their first win in Fort Worth in three seasons.
Utah (7-5-3, 2-2-2 Big 12) will host No. 21 Colorado before heading south to face Baylor. The Utes enter the weekend on the heels of back-to-back 1-0 road wins over Houston and Arizona. Their only other matchup against a ranked opponent this season came in their Big 12 opener, a loss to then-No. 14 TCU.
The Utes lead the all-time series 2-1, with Baylor's lone victory coming in 1997. The teams last met a season ago in Salt Lake City, where Utah earned a 2-0 win. The Bears are in search of their first win over the Utes since Utah joined the Big 12.
Baylor holds the No. 10 spot in the latest United Soccer Coaches poll, released through matches played on Oct. 12, and sits at No. 4 in both the NCAA Division I Committee's Top 16 and RPI. With TCU ranked No. 14 in the same coaches' poll and No. 5 in the committee rankings and RPI.
